1. Calculate the wind pressure for the given building
a. Building Dimension : 20m x 30m x 20m height RCC
b. Building usage : Hospital block in city centre
c. Location : Darjeeling
From IS 875 Part - 3 2015
Design wind speed (Vz)
Vz = Vb x k1 x k2 x k3 x k4
Where,
Vz = Design wind speed at height z in m/s
k1 = Probability factor (risk co-efficient)
k2 = terrain roughness and height factor
k3 = Topography factor
k4 = Importance factor for cyclonic region
From Annex - A the wind speed is 47 m/s for Darjeeling
From table 1 wkt hospital builidng is a Important builidng and design life of structure is 100 years
So for 47m/s wind speed k1 = 1.07
To find k2 first we have to see the category of building which it lies
our builidng lies in Category 4
Height of the building is 20m
From table 2 for the category 4 and 20m height k2 = 0.80
From topography factor k3 = 1
From importance factor for cyclic region k4 = 1.3
Vz = Vb x k1 x k2 x k3 x k4
Vz = 47x1.07x0.80x1x1.3
Vz = 52.30m/s
Calculation of wind pressure
Pz = 0.6 x Vz^2
Pz = 0.6x52.30^2
Pz = 1641.174 N
Pz = 1.64 KN

Live load
Calculating live load as per IS 875 Part 2
Occupancy Live load
For wards, dressign rooms and lounges 2 KN/m^2
Kitchen and labratories 3 KN/m^2
Dining room and cafeterians 3 KN/m^2
Toilets and bathrooms 2 KN/m^2
X-ray rooms and Operating rooms 3 KN/m^2
Office room and OPD rooms 2.5 KN/m^2
Corridors, passage, lobbies and stairs 4 KN/m^2
